A Graduate Certificate in Referral Marketing provides specialized training in leveraging the power of word-of-mouth marketing for business growth. This focused program equips students with the skills to design, implement, and analyze effective referral programs.
Learning outcomes typically include mastering referral program strategy, understanding customer relationship management (CRM) in the context of referrals, proficiently using referral marketing software and analytics, and developing compelling referral incentives. Students gain practical experience through case studies and potentially even project-based learning, preparing them for immediate application in the workplace.
The duration of a Graduate Certificate in Referral Marketing varies, but generally ranges from a few months to a year, depending on the institution and program intensity. This allows for a flexible learning experience that can complement existing professional commitments.
Industry relevance is exceptionally high. Referral marketing is a highly effective and cost-efficient channel for acquiring new customers and building brand loyalty. Graduates with this certificate are in high demand across various industries, including SaaS, e-commerce, and professional services, making it a valuable asset for career advancement or a change in professional focus. Skills in affiliate marketing and influencer marketing are often complementary and integrated into the curriculum.
The program covers key aspects like creating engaging referral campaigns, optimizing for various marketing channels, and measuring the return on investment (ROI) of referral marketing initiatives.
